Types of GPS

There are several different types of GPS units for Mobile phones out there in the market and you need to ascertain whether they meet your specifications and needs. There are five major categories of GPS units.

•    Handheld GPS units are the ones that you can use in your device such as your mobile phone or even in a personal digital assistant (PDA). Most people opt for this variant as it gives them several different uses. It comes laden with all the specifications and caters to the needs of the people right away. The users of this particular kind of device can easily find out their location with the use of the internet and map it on it.

•    Auto mounted GPS these are the units that are found in vehicles in order to go on and help drivers locate their destinations. There are some of these GPS units that allow you to be able to get the minutest of details right from every turn that you need to take. This can be extremely helpful for drivers who are not familiar with the terrain and the locations.

•    GPS units for Sports. These units can be used quite effortlessly for sports purposes such as by golfers, sailors and hikers. These are extremely small devices and can even be fitted in a watch. They come with the best of maps and a compass to help navigate your way through.

•    Commercial and Government GPS units. These units are essentially designed to be able to give the right kind of tracking aid to military and for specific operations. These can also be used by parents to keep tabs on their children, by employers to keep tabs on their employees especially those in the marketing fields. This can serve as a valuable tool to find out the whereabouts of a person.
